What is another word for FIRST?

Synonyms for FIRST
fɜrstfirst

This thesaurus page includes all potential synonyms, words with the same meaning and similar terms for the word FIRST.

Complete Dictionary of Synonyms and Antonyms0.0 / 0 votes

  1. first

    Synonyms:
    leading, primary, pristine, original, foremost, primitive, principal, primeval, highest, chief, earliest, onmost

    Antonyms:
    subsequent, secondary, subordinate, subservient, lowest, unimportant, last, hindmost
